Abstract

The utility model relates to the field of structural member installation, in particular to a unit assembling auxiliary device for a large-scale factory building, which is characterized by comprising a cross beam, support bases, lifting rings and a lifting device formed by traction chains, wherein the at least two support bases are arranged at two ends of the cross beam respectively; the lifting rings are symmetrically arranged on the two sides of the bottom of the cross beam; the two traction chains pass through the two lifting rings respectively.

Background technology
The general overlength monomer members of steel structure large-sized workshop, need the segmentation transportation, and the field by using crane is spelling on assembled moulding bed, but this method adjusts difficulty very large when interface misplaces, and not only Occupation coefficient time-consuming but also crane is also low.
Summary of the invention
The purpose of this utility model is to provide a kind of large-sized workshop cell cube spelling auxiliary device, and it is simple in structure, easy to use, can effectively realize the pre-splicing of overlength member, for the actual splicing operation of member is provided convenience.
In order to achieve the above object, the utility model is achieved in that
A kind of large-sized workshop cell cube spelling auxiliary device, it comprises the lifting appliance that crossbeam, supporting seat, suspension ring and conduction chain form; Supporting seat has two at least, is located at respectively the crossbeam two ends, and suspension ring are symmetrically set in the crossbeam two bottom sides, and conduction chain has two, is through at respectively in two suspension ring.
Described overlength member splicing auxiliary ceiling suspension, also comprise two bottom guide tracks that be arranged in parallel, and lifting appliance has a plurality of, and its sliding block joint by supporting seat and bottom guide track is located on bottom guide track.
The utility model adopts above-mentioned design, simple in structure, easy to use, has reduced the dependence of overlength member splicing to crane, for the splicing of overlength member provides convenience.

The specific embodiment
Below further illustrate the utility model by specific embodiment.
As shown in Figure 1 and Figure 2, a kind of large-sized workshop cell cube spelling auxiliary device, it comprises the lifting appliance that crossbeam 1, supporting seat 2, suspension ring and conduction chain 3 form; Supporting seat 2 has two, is located at respectively crossbeam 1 two ends, and suspension ring are symmetrically set in crossbeam 1 two bottom sides, and conduction chain 3 has two, is through at respectively in two suspension ring.
The concrete operations of this device are as follows:
1, assembled place is carried out smooth, according to the physical dimension of member, sleeper 4 is set, will put on sleeper 4 by assembled member with crane, and member is carried out tentatively assembled;
2, lifting appliance is erected to the position of assembled each 2m of interface of distance, at least set up one one on every section member, for convenience of operation, between each lifting appliance, can connect by guide rail 5, the distance between each lifting appliance is controlled in the slip by supporting seat 2 on guide rail 5;
3, hang respectively jack in the crossbeam both sides, utilize conduction chain 3 that sectional members is promoted and leaves sleeper 4, adjacent two sections members are maintained at the same horizontal plane substantially;
4, pull respectively each conduction chain 3, to the modular level degree, squareness, trickle adjustment is carried out in the interface gap;
5, repetition measurement errorless after, on sleeper 5 pad establish drift carry out temporary fixed, finally the welding.
